Guest sonnyskare Posted February 5, 2014 Report Share Posted February 5, 2014 A list of songs by wisp, feel free to fill in what I'm missing. I know he has a LOT of songs out there and I only have a handful. Albums: 2003 - pleeper ep 2003 - Frozen Days 2004 - saw2 reworked 2004 - A Thousand Tomorrows 2004 - ..about things that never were. 2006 - Building Dragons 2004 - Cultivar 2004 - fungusFLAP EP 2004 - Xmas87 2006 - Honor Beats 2004 - humpeIndenBEATS 2004 - Let Me See Your Shapes 2003 - In A Blue Face 2005 - Lost In A Walk EP 2008 - Katabatic 2007 - Growth EP (Which I think is pretty hush hush I don't hear much about it) 2008 - Shadow Men (I don't think you can get this one) 2005 - NRTHNDR 2009 - The Shimmering Hour 2009 - We Miss You Collaboration Albums: 2007 - Mrs. Jynx & Wisp Present: From Us To You 2009 - nine acid (vhom/skønflap) 2004 - Quest For Excalipur Mixes: Flimsy Pipetts Mix Ivanhoe Mix (He has some more mixes out there, Idk where they are) Songs (includes myspace, soundcloud, remixes, and album appearances): Wisp Pt 1. patternoverlap Posted February 12, 2014 Report Share Posted February 12, 2014 You are missing a Havaer release. Believe it was called Listening Advice or something along those lines. I'll have to check when I get home. Dunno how available it is. He also had an alias called Ent Sounds that was super lo fi ambient type stuff. There was also a CDr that he made available in addition to In a Blue Face around 2003-04ish but I'm failing to remember the name of that too.
